If you’ve been backing up your Blu-ray and DVD collection for years, you’ve likely run into this dreaded message. Cinavia is a DRM (Digital Rights Management) system designed to prevent unauthorized copying. Unlike old school CSS encryption, Cinavia hides an inaudible code in the audio track itself. dvdfab cinavia list

The "DVDFab Cinavia List" is an unofficial, community-driven database (often shared on forums and the official DVDFab blog) that tracks which Blu-ray and DVD titles contain the Cinavia watermark. Because Cinavia is embedded in the audio stream, it is notoriously difficult to remove. DVDFab offers a specific tool called (part of the All-In-One package). However, this removal process works differently depending on the source.
